Decoding the Math Behind the Shiny Offer
Imagine you snag a 100% match up to £200. You think you’re getting a free £200, but the fine print demands a 30x wagering requirement on the bonus alone. That translates to £6,000 of play before you can touch a single penny of the extra cash. It’s like being handed a free ticket to a marathon that only ends when you collapse.
Bet365, for example, rolls out a “first deposit boost” that looks generous on the surface. Yet their terms force you to chase the bonus through low‑risk games that pay out pennies while the wagering meter ticks inexorably upward. The same pattern shows up at William Hill, where the “VIP welcome” is really a VIP‑priced trap.
Because the casino’s revenue model is built on the fact that most players will never meet the wagering bar, the bonus serves as a psychological hook, not a financial lifeline. The moment you hit a win, the system wipes it clean with a suddenly higher bet limit, ensuring you keep feeding the house.

What the Savvy Player Does Differently
Instead of chasing the biggest headline bonus, a seasoned gambler scrutinises the wagering multiplier, the game eligibility list, and the maximum cash‑out limit. If a casino caps the cash‑out at £100 on a £500 bonus, the deal is effectively a £0.20‑to‑£1 exchange. That’s not a bargain; that’s a tax on optimism.
Moreover, the best‑behaved players keep a spreadsheet. They log every deposit, bonus, wagered amount, and the games they used. The data quickly reveals which brands actually deliver a reasonable chance of clearing the bonus versus those that simply inflate the numbers to look attractive. In my experience, only a handful of operators provide a clear path, and even then the journey is riddled with tiny, aggravating details.
Because the industry thrives on the illusion of generosity, the true “best 1st deposit bonus casino” is the one that offers the lowest wagering requirement, the widest game selection, and a transparent cash‑out policy. Anything less is just marketing fluff, a shiny veneer over a well‑worn trap.
